ClarityPeak is a digital solutions provider based in Chennai, India, specializing in web design, lead generation, business analytics, and SEO services.

memoryBlue is a sales development consulting firm specializing in outsourced sales and lead generation for high-tech clients, offering SDR and BDR outsourcing to accelerate pipeline growth.
